1. Anti-Snoring Mouthpieces

Anti-snoring mouthpieces are one of the most popular tools for snoring cessation. These devices work by keeping your airways open and preventing your tongue from falling back, which can cause snoring. There are different types of mouthpieces available, such as mandibular advancement devices and tongue retaining devices. These devices are easy to use and can provide immediate relief from snoring.

2. Nasal Dilators

Nasal dilators are small devices that you insert into your nostrils to keep them open while you sleep. They work by widening your nasal passages, allowing air to flow freely through your nose and reducing snoring. Nasal dilators are ideal for people who snore due to nasal congestion or allergies. They are also easy to use and can provide quick relief from snoring.

3. Sleep Trackers

Sleep trackers are devices or apps that monitor your sleep patterns and provide insights into your sleep quality. These trackers can also detect snoring and provide data on the frequency and intensity of your snoring. By analyzing this data, you can identify patterns and make necessary changes to improve your sleep and reduce snoring.

4. Snoring Relief Sprays

Snoring relief sprays are another popular tool for snoring cessation. These sprays contain natural ingredients that lubricate and tighten the tissues in your throat and reduce snoring. Some sprays also contain anti-inflammatory properties that can help reduce swelling in the nasal passages, making it easier to breathe while sleeping.

5. Snoring Relief Pillows

Snoring relief pillows are specially designed to keep your head and neck aligned while you sleep. These pillows can help open your airways and prevent snoring. Some snoring relief pillows also have special features such as adjustable height, which allows you to customize the pillow to your specific needs.

6. White Noise Apps

White noise apps work by creating a constant sound that can help mask the sound of snoring. These apps have a variety of sounds to choose from, such as rain, ocean waves, or a fan. The continuous sound can help you relax and fall asleep, reducing the chances of being disturbed by snoring.

7. Snoring Detection Apps

Snoring detection apps use your smartphone’s microphone to detect snoring sounds while you sleep. These apps can record your snoring and provide detailed reports on the intensity and frequency of your snoring. Some apps also have features that can help you track your sleep patterns and make necessary changes to improve your sleep quality.
